Why get_manager_config needs a policy

This tool retrieves configuration data from the Wazuh manager without modifying, deleting, or executing any operations. It is purely informational, making it a Read category tool with low severity. While configuration details could be sensitive, exposure is limited to viewing existing settings rather than enabling unauthorized changes or system-level actions.

From the tool's definition Tool name 'get_manager_config' and description 'Get the active Wazuh manager configuration for a specific section' indicate a retrieval operation with no modification or execution of commands.

Can I rate-limit get_manager_config? +

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the get_manager_config r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.

How do I block get_manager_config completely? +

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for get_manager_config.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
